Output 41bb579150fda86f5f1bbdad04de9761f52cb97bf4c265fe1b1e2c89f562db2a:17

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ff7f1282f80f3e8612949d89a15bede0c1aacf4 OP_EQUAL
address
3KC41VmniQEZStxwbxKwduHvqj9N5yWtbD
transaction
41bb579150fda86f5f1bbdad04de9761f52cb97bf4c265fe1b1e2c89f562db2a
confirmations
268777
spent
true